Editorial Reviews:

Book Description
A Stitch in Time, written by “The Voice of the Astros,” Gene Elston, chronicles the extraordinary and exciting highlights of baseball from the early days of the game until today. The reader will find an easy to read day-by-day format beginning with January and continuing through December. The notable events of each day of the year are recorded in Mr. Elston's familiar style.

A Stitch in Time details events from all areas of the game, including notable events in the major leagues, good coverage of the minor leagues, women in baseball, the Negro leagues, as well as behind-the-scene trades, scandals, machinations, and other highlights. Mr. Elston provides a wealth of baseball facts, insight, and rare photos that only a lifetime of involvement in the game can provide. Includes a 10-page index to aid in baseball research.
